Biotechnology Engineer graduated from the Catholic University of Santa María (2019), an institution that awarded her a full scholarship for her academic performance and services as a researcher at the university's Renewable Energy Institute, where she gained experience in environmental bioremediation. She completed an international internship at the National Polytechnic Institute in Mexico, where she acquired knowledge in wastewater treatment from the textile industry. She worked as a laboratory analyst at Policlinico Garcia Bragagnini (2020). She was selected by the OAS to pursue a master's degree as a scholarship holder at the Lorena School of Engineering at the University of São Paulo-Brazil (2021). She currently holds a Master of Science degree from the Industrial Biotechnology program, with expertise in molecular biology (expression, production and purification of proteins) and manipulation of oxidative enzymes (LPMOs) for application in lignin. She has knowledge in data analysis of chromatographic and analytical techniques (HPLC, ÄKTA pure, LCMS, NMR, SEC). In addition to her native language, Spanish, she speaks Portuguese and English.
